Passport Applications in Bogor Now Available on Weekends: Here Are the Requirements
The Bogor Class I Non-TPI Immigration Office is opening passport application services on weekends through the MEDISA programme. This service provides access for the public who cannot process passports during weekdays. The programme is limited to expedited passports with a maximum quota of 50 applicants every Saturday. Head of the Bogor Immigration Office, Ritus Ramadhana, stated that this service is expected to keep the passport processing quick and measured. “We provide this service to give convenience to the public who have time limitations on weekdays. With a quota of 50 applicants every Saturday, we want to ensure the process remains quick and measured,” said Ritus. Registration is done through the M-Paspor application before coming to the office. Applicants must bring their e-KTP, old passport, and Rp10,000 stamp duty for passport replacement. In addition to weekend services, Bogor Immigration also introduces the WISTI innovation or fixed rest time serving. Through a rotating officer system, services continue without interruption during break times. Ritus said this innovation aims to cut down waiting times for the public. “We want to ensure the public still receives services without having to wait for the service hours to reopen. This is part of our commitment to providing fast and comfortable services,” said Ritus. He explained that Bogor Immigration also implements the Dharma Warga Bogor programme by directly visiting applicants who cannot come to the office, such as the elderly or patients. “Through this programme, we want to ensure immigration services reach all levels of society, including those with mobility limitations,” said Ritus. For expedited services, the electronic passport fee is set at Rp1,650,000 for a 5-year validity period and Rp1,950,000 for 10 years.
